      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;img src=&#34;http://warmlamphub.com/images/98c91c18a371aa308d265d33bcef1a5c.jpg&#34; alt=&#34;600mm Clear Quartz Infrared Carbon Heating Lamp&#34;&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#xA;&lt;p&gt;We built this 600mm Clear Quartz Infrared Carbon Heating Lamp for one reason: when you need intense, pinpoint heat in a tight spot, it just delivers.&#xA;This isn&amp;rsquo;t a general-purpose heater. It&amp;rsquo;s a specialist. The kind you bring in when the job calls for fast, high-density heat—like PET blowing, thermoforming, or curing.&#xA;Here&amp;rsquo;s the heart of it: &lt;a href=&#34;https://o-yate.net&#34;&gt;power&lt;/a&gt; and size.&#xA;At 600mm long, this lamp throws a serious punch. It fires up in seconds, blasting out shortwave infrared that goes straight to the target. No wasted energy heating the air. Just direct, focused heat. That means your cycle times get faster.&#xA;But with that kind of power, you need a solid foundation. Make sure your control circuitry can handle the continuous load. It’s a small step that keeps the whole system from burning out too soon.&#xA;We chose clear quartz for a reason.&#xA;It lets the infrared energy pass through with almost no loss, and it handles &lt;a href=&#34;https://henruite.com&#34;&gt;sudden&lt;/a&gt; temperature swings way better than standard glass. Inside, the carbon filament spreads the heat across a broad spectrum, so plastics and coatings warm evenly—no hot spots, no guesswork.&#xA;And the R7s connector? It&amp;rsquo;s practical. It holds up in industrial settings, handles high current, and makes swapping the lamp during maintenance a simple, drop-in job.&#xA;In the real world, this lamp shines where space is tight but heat can&amp;rsquo;t take a back seat.&#xA;Think about &lt;a href=&#34;https://o-yate.com&#34;&gt;melting&lt;/a&gt; parisons in PET blowing, or &lt;a href=&#34;https://goldisgood.com&#34;&gt;softening&lt;/a&gt; sheets right before forming. You get the focused energy you need, right where you need it.&#xA;The trade-off is heat management.&#xA;That concentrated power is effective, but it means your machine needs proper ventilation to keep neighboring parts from getting too hot. The lamp is built tough, but the surrounding system has to be ready for the heat, too.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
